102220032202 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 153330048306. Its totient is φ = 51110016100.
The previous prime is 102220032181. The next prime is 102220032217. The reversal of 102220032202 is 202230022201.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 100862772921 + 1357259281 = 317589^2 + 36841^2 .
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 25555008049 + ... + 25555008052.
Almost surely, 2102220032202 is an apocalyptic number.
102220032202 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(51110016104).
102220032202 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
102220032202 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 51110016103.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 192, while the sum is 16.
Adding to 102220032202 its reverse (202230022201), we get a palindrome (304450054403).
The spelling of 102220032202 in words is "one hundred two billion, two hundred twenty million, thirty-two thousand, two hundred two".
